Join our small and nimble engineering team!

  • Work in our downtown San Francisco office a few times per week

  • Create and manage data collection scripts that utilize everything from basic HTTP requests to browser and mobile app automation

  • Build and maintain automation/scheduling tooling to ensure data is collected on a timely and consistent basis

  • Create data cleaning and normalization scripts (with some opportunity to integrate ML/LLMs if that’s of interest)

  • Design data analytics dashboards and tooling for continuous monitoring and improvement of the processed data

  • Help with miscellaneous DevOps tasks to help manage the infrastructure running all the above

  • Our codebase is mostly Python with Typescript and Golang used when they make sense

About you
  • Skills: Python, SQL, Unix

  • Excited to work on a variety of different projects, sometimes many at the same time

  • Able to execute with minimal supervision

  • Bonus skills: Web Crawling, Docker, Kubernetes, Full Stack Web Development, Mobile App Development, Background in Statistics

Benefits
  • Lunch provided when in office

  • Unlimited PTO

  • 401k

  • Company paid Platinum PPO health and comparable dental & vision insurance

  • $100K - $150K salary, 0.25% - 1% equity

About the interview
  1. 15 minute call with CTO about the position, your experience, and career goals

  2. 1st 30 minute technical screening call (coding interview)

  3. 2nd 30 minute technical screening call (coding interview)

  4. Onsite at our office to learn more about us and to get a feel for how we’d work together

  5. Offer extended

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
